Abstract
Embodiments of the present disclosure propose a solution for reporting with channel status waving. According to embodiments of this present disclosure, a terminal device determines one or more time durations for reporting and preconfiguring with the channel status waving. The terminal device transmits parameters related to channel status and/or adjusts its power in accordance with the one or more time durations. In this way, it can improve the reporting of channel status information and configuration efficiency with reduced overhead.

36 . A method, comprising:
determining, at a first device, a time duration for reporting channel status information; and transmitting, from the first device to a second device, a set of one or more parameters related to the channel status information based on the time duration.
37 . The method of claim 36 , wherein transmitting the set of one or more parameters related to the channel status information comprises:
transmitting, to the second device, at least one of the following for the time duration:
a maximum value of the channel status information,
a minimum value of the channel status information,
an increasing rate of the channel status information,
a decreasing rate of the channel status information,
a changing rate of the channel status information,
a starting value of the channel status information,
an ending value of the channel status information, or
a changing pattern of the channel status information.
38 . The method of claim 36 , wherein transmitting the one or more set of parameters related to the channel status information comprises:
transmitting, to the second device, at least one of the following for the time duration:
a first time instant or time range for a maximum value of the channel status information,
a second time instant or time range for a minimum value of the channel status information,
a third time instant or time range for a starting value of the channel status information, or
a fourth time instant or time range for an ending value of the channel status information.
39 . The method of claim 36 , further comprising:
receiving, from a second device, a configuration for reporting channel status information, wherein determining the time duration comprises determining the time duration based on the received configuration, and wherein the configuration for reporting the channel status information comprises at least one of:
information related to a reference interference level for determining the channel status information for the time duration,
information related to a time slot index or a time period that the channel status information is related to, or
information for a time slot index or time period that the set of one or more parameters is related to.
40 . The method of claim 36 , wherein determining the time duration comprises:
determining a plurality of the time durations; and transmitting, to the second device, a set of one or more parameters related to the channel status information for each of the time durations.
41 . The method of claim 36 , wherein at least one of: value of the channel status information is increasing within a first portion of the time duration, or the value of the channel status information is decreasing within a second portion of the time duration.
42 . The method of claim 36 , further comprising:
determining at least one period for reporting the channel status information within the time duration; and wherein transmitting the set of parameters related to the channel status information comprises transmitting the set of parameters for the at least one period.
43 . The method of claim 36 , further comprising:
transmitting, to the second device, channel status information as differential information to the set of one or more parameters.
44 . The method of claim 36 , further comprising:
transmitting, to the second device, at least one channel status information report in advance to a start of the time duration.
